Do you know where the world’s largest submerged volcanic tunnel is located? 

It can be found on Lanzarotea Spanish island that can be found on the Atlantic Ocean. This tourist destination accommodates thousands upon thousands of travelers each year because of the great tourist attractions topped off with a mild dry climate. This makes Lanzarote a perfect year-round destination.





Flights to Lanzarote are available 7 days a week, and the length of travel depends on your point of origin. If you are from the UK, the flight usually takes about 4 to 4 ½ hours during good weather conditions. You can book a flight from a wide variety of airlines such as Jet2 flights, Aer Lingus, Ryanair fly and easyJet.
